Week One: Spring One Room Challenge

April 8, 2023

Week One

I am excited to challenge myself this year by participating in the One Room Challenge. As an interior designer, I’m no stranger to renovations and executing projects from a mood board to a complete project. But I must admit, when it comes to my home, some projects have been overlooked as I have made client projects my top priority.

So this spring, I decided to participate in the One Room Challenge and change our gorgeous home office featured in Better Homes & Gardens (sigh!) into our dream toddler room for my son. And if you are not sure what the One Room Challenge is, let me fill you in on the project.

The One Room Challenge, aka ORC, was started over ten years ago by Linda Weinstein, the founder who wanted to do a one-room design challenge with online besties to create a room. She found that by working together as a design community, design lovers could work together to meet this challenge. Over the years, it has blossomed into a bi-annual event for interior designers and influencers to share their interior design tips, DIY skills, and everything in between that comes with big or small home renovations.

The Backstory

So when I moved into my home a few years ago, our extra third bedroom was converted into an office space for my husband. And—I learned while preparing for a home tour with Better Homes & Gardens that I was pregnant with my son. Fast forward to today, the office is gone, and what’s left is a makeshift nursery that needs a lot of TLC, and the true Angela Belt Interiors touch to make it shine. Below, check out the before images of the space, and in the following weeks, I will share how I will give this small space a major upgrade.

THE VISION

I’m excited to transform this office into a toddler-friendly room with fun design elements and maximize the storage for organization. Some of the design challenges to address in the space are listed below:

  • Insulation

  • Closet organization

  • Toy organization

  • Designated play area

  • Multiple lighting options

  • Air purifier/humidifier

  • Maximize the square footage
